If your fireplace is a factory-built prefab unit — the metal-bodied fireboxes in most Dallas homes built from the 1980s on — the inside isn't laid brick. It's lined with molded refractory panels: manufactured heat-resistant boards that protect the metal firebox and reflect heat. Those panels crack with use, and when they do, replacing them is a specific, defined repair. Panel replacement restores the firebox to safe operation with the correct parts, not a patch.

Why Refractory Panels Crack

Refractory panels take the direct heat of every fire, and cracking is the normal end of their service life. Sharp temperature swings, logs shifting against them, impacts from loading wood, and simple age all crack panels over time. A crack you can see is expected eventually; the questions are whether it's reached the point of replacement and whether the metal firebox behind it is now exposed. A crack wide enough to see the metal shell through — roughly the width of a coin's edge — is the common industry threshold for replacement.

Why cracked panels matter: The panels shield the metal firebox from direct flame. Once they crack through, heat reaches the metal shell it was protecting, which can warp or fail — and a compromised prefab firebox is a fire-safety concern. Significantly cracked panels should be replaced before continuing to burn.

The Right Panels for Your Unit

Prefab fireplaces are manufacturer-specific systems, and the replacement panels have to match the make and model — the correct size, thickness, and fit for your unit. Generic or ill-fitting panels don't seat properly and don't protect correctly. We identify your fireplace's manufacturer and model and fit the right refractory panels, so the repair restores the firebox the way it was designed. This is what separates panel replacement from a masonry firebox repair, which is for brick-built fireboxes and uses refractory mortar and firebrick instead of manufactured panels.

Frequently Asked Questions, Firebox Panel Replacement in Dallas

How do I know if I have a prefab firebox with panels or a masonry one?

A prefab firebox has a metal body lined with smooth molded refractory panels — common in Dallas homes built from the 1980s on. A masonry firebox is built from individual laid firebricks with mortar joints. Panels crack as flat boards; brick cracks brick by brick. We identify which you have and use the right repair.

When do refractory panels need to be replaced?

The common threshold is a crack wide enough to see the metal firebox shell through it — roughly the width of a coin's edge — or panels that are crumbling or spalling. At that point the panel no longer protects the metal behind it, and it should be replaced before continuing to burn.

Are cracked panels dangerous?

Significantly cracked ones are a concern. The panels shield the metal firebox from direct flame; once they crack through, heat reaches and can warp or fail the metal shell, which is a fire-safety issue. That's why panels cracked to the point of exposing the metal should be replaced.

Can you use any replacement panels?

No — prefab fireplaces are manufacturer-specific, so the panels must match your make and model in size, thickness, and fit. Generic panels don't seat or protect correctly. We identify your unit and fit the right refractory panels so the repair restores it as designed.

Do I need to replace the whole fireplace if the panels are cracked?

Usually not. Many homeowners assume a cracked interior means the fireplace is finished, but prefab units have replaceable panels — swapping them restores the firebox for far less than replacing the whole fireplace. It's one of the most common and economical prefab firebox repairs.
